In this chilling one-minute tale, we explore the shadowy corners of a Tokyo apartment where something sinister hides behind the ordinary. Inspired by Japanese urban legends, "The Woman Behind the Curtain" is a short horror story about hesitation, fear, and the consequences of answering too slowly. Turn down the lights, put on your headphones, and ask yourself—what would you say if she asked, “Am I beautiful?”
